Re: [PD] partconv~ outputs silence

2015-07-17 Thread Alexandre Torres Porres
partconv~ needs to receive a set message to set the table, otherwise it
wont work with the specified array given as the first argument and it will
crash. So it needs a loadbang to set the table. I contacted the author
(bensaylor), who said this is a known bug but that he didn't have time to
work on it.

I tried to make a bug report on on it just now, but sourceforge seems to be
down - i got http://sourceforge.net/error-404.html

Le 14/07/2015 16:53, IOhannes m zmoelnig a écrit :
> On 2015-07-14 16:11, Jack wrote:
>> Hello,
>> 
>> Jumping fast to certain coefficient (for frequency around 40/50
>> Hz and Q around 0.7) cut sound on iOS (iPad) when i use libpd (it
>> seems to be OK with MacOSX). I need to restart the iOS after. Do
>> you know what I have to do to solve this issue ?
> 
> provide a test-patch.
> 
> two ideas: - the quick jump causes some very high sample values.
> the iOS system limiter~ mutes the signal and takes ages to recover
> (too long to wait). a quick fix would be to use [clip~] just before
> the [dac~]s
> 
> - the quick jump might cause a NaN to be introduced in the signal 
> vector; due to the recursive nature of [biquad~] all successive
> samples become NaNs. no quick fix for this. try to get the sample
> values after muting. e.g. using [print~], or even just [env~]...

[PD] partconv~ outputs silence

2015-07-17 Thread Matthias Blau

Hello list,

I'm having trouble using partconv~ in a freshly compiled pd-0.46.6 on 
Ubuntu 14.04.


First, if I use the distro-supplied pd-bsaylor package, then I get the 
usual 64bit error message:
"An operation on the array '1003-ns_coeffs' in the patch 
'1003-ns_coeffs' failed since it uses garray_getfloatarray while running 
64-bit!"


I then compiled bsaylor from svn (partconv~.c from 2013/01/02, where 
64bit access is supposedly fixed) and voila - no error message, pd 
apparently loads partconv~ ok:

"partconv~: using 1003-ns_coeffs in 1 partitions with FFT-size 1024"

Unfortunately, I don't get anything out of the filter. The fiter itself 
works (e.g. using FIR~).


Any hints?
Thanks, Matthias
